Transaction ae3f58217317da0b50da6778a7426a4d98de12bf232aeb08bebfa1e020915472
2 Input
2 Outputs
- ae3f58217317da0b50da6778a7426a4d98de12bf232aeb08bebfa1e020915472:0
- ae3f58217317da0b50da6778a7426a4d98de12bf232aeb08bebfa1e020915472:1
value 149750
address 199HkpPiQq7PX5sacxnkUhFHoTyZj1uhky
value 3963641
address 33JCT8toL1C4r5usxDSWBG8zqYmMmevnvA